Quilter: Physics-Based Autonomous AI PCB Design Software
What is Quilter? Quilter is a PCB (Printed Circuit Board) design software that uses physics-based AI to automate the layout process. It aims to accelerate hardware innovation by allowing engineers to iterate quickly and independently.
How does Quilter work? Unlike traditional AI tools that assist designers, Quilter executes the PCB layout process autonomously. Users input constraints, and Quilter generates the output files. It enables early design exploration and rapid board independence, allowing engineers to receive working layouts in a short time.
